REPUBLIC OF KENYA
THE NATIONAL POLICE SERVICE (NPS)
RECRUITMENT OF POLICE CONSTABLES
Pursuant to Chapter VI and Articles 10; 27(8); 232; 246(3); 246(4) of the Constitution of Kenya; Sections 10, 11 and 12 of the National Police Service Commission Act and section 7 (3) of the National Police Service Commission Recruitment and Appointment Regulations 2015, I the Inspector General, in exercise of powers delegated to me by the National Police Service Commission, seek to recruit 10,000 suitably qualified applicants to be trained as Police Constables.
- ENTRY REQUIREMENTS
Entry Applicant must:
- Be a citizen of Kenya
- Hold a Kenya National Identity Card
- Possess a minimum mean grade of D+ (D Plus) and above in the Kenya Certificate of Secondary
Education (KCSE) examination or its equivalent from an examination body recognized in Kenya with a D+ (D Plus) and above in either English or Kiswahili languages
- Be aged between 18 and 28 years
- Meet the requirements of Chapter Six of the Constitution
- Be physically and mentally fit
- Have no criminal record or pending criminal charges
- Female Candidates must NOT be pregnant at recruitment and during the ENTIRE training period.
- Applicants with the following skills are also encouraged to apply; Forensic Scientists, Carpenters and Joiners, Cartographers, Clinical Officers, Nurses, Draughtsmen, Electrical Assistants, Electronics Technicians, General Fitters, Foreign Languages Experts , Hospitality(Caterers, Waiters, Housekeepers, Cooks, Laundry Operators), ICT Experts, Laboratory Technicians, Librarians, Masons, Metal Workers, Motor Vehicle Mechanics, Motor Vehicle Panel Beaters, Musicians/Bandsmen, Painters and Sign Writers, Photographers, Plant Mechanics, Plant Operators, Pharmacists, Plumbers, Sign Language Interpreters, Sportsmen/Women, Tailors, Vehicle Electricians, Veterinary Technicians, Video Editors, Videographers, Welders and Fabricators.
NOTE:
- Examinations Result slips shall not be accepted.
- An applicant who
- Canvasses directly or indirectly,
- Willfully presents false academic certificates and testimonials or
- Engages in any corrupt activity
Shall be disqualified, and in the case of (b) and (c) will in addition be arrested and prosecuted.
Under section 25 of the National Police Service Commission Act, any person who willfully gives to the Commission any information which is false or misleading in any material particular, commits an offence and shall on conviction be liable to a fine not exceeding two hundred thousand shillings (Ksh. 200,000) or to imprisonment for a term not exceeding two (2) years or both.
- GENDER BALANCE & DIVERSITY
The recruited applicants shall reflect the gender, ethnic and regional diversity of the Kenyan people.
- APPLICATION SUBMISSION
All Candidates must complete the prescribed application form obtainable from ANY of the following:
- The nearest Officer Commanding Police Division (OCPD) or any Police Station.
- The nearest Sub – County Administration Police Commander’s (SUBCOM) Offices.
- County Commissioner’s Offices
- The nearest Huduma Centre

All applications must be submitted in duplicate accompanied with the following documents:
- A copy of the academic certificates and testimonials
- A copy of the Kenya National ID
- A copy of the applicant’s Birth Certificate
- Police Clearance Certificate
Applicants must present themselves at the Recruitment Centre with the duly completed form indicating the Service of preference on the day of the recruitment exercise.
NOTE:
- Each applicant must present the original supporting documents for verification. The originals will be returned to the applicant before the applicant leaves the recruitment centre.
- Applicants recruited for the training into the service shall be bonded to serve in the National Police Service for a minimum period of ten (10) years.
- COMMENCEMENT OF RECRUITMENT
The recruitment process will commence on 11th May 2017 from 8:00am to 5:00pm at the listed Constituency-based Recruitment Centers.
All applicants must be at their respective recruitment center by 8:00am.
